Transaction cc8e33bfbcac6c2e4e114d28e4e367402948911deb471666452175783b5d6e28
1 Input
1 Output
-
cc8e33bfbcac6c2e4e114d28e4e367402948911deb471666452175783b5d6e28:0
- value
- 333091
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a6b69ba51ec3b367eee5878c3d07c5dda3bc9ea OP_EQUAL
- address
- 3BPiE4etwnF83fHLrsSmyX4Yquj2K8fvi5